How to find the GCF of 82710 and 82727?

We will first find the prime factorization of 82710 and 82727. After we will calculate the factors of 82710 and 82727 and find the biggest common factor number .

Step-1: Prime Factorization of 82710

Prime factors of 82710 are 2, 3, 5, 919. Prime factorization of 82710 in exponential form is:

82710 = 21 × 32 × 51 × 9191

Step-2: Prime Factorization of 82727

Prime factors of 82727 are 82727. Prime factorization of 82727 in exponential form is:

82727 = 827271

Step-3: Factors of 82710

List of positive integer factors of 82710 that divides 82710 without a remainder.

1, 2, 3, 5, 6, 9, 10, 15, 18, 30, 45, 90, 919, 1838, 2757, 4595, 5514, 8271, 9190, 13785, 16542, 27570, 41355

Step-4: Factors of 82727

List of positive integer factors of 82727 that divides 82710 without a remainder.

1

Final Step: Biggest Common Factor Number

We found the factors and prime factorization of 82710 and 82727. The biggest common factor number is the GCF number.
So the greatest common factor 82710 and 82727 is 1.
